> I have installed VMWare Workstation 6.5.1 on jaunty (9.04).
> It installed successfully but when I run /usr/bin/vmware
> I get following messages:
>
> Logging to /tmp/vmware-root/setup-7749.log
> modinfo: could not find module vmmon
> modinfo: could not find module vmnet
> modinfo: could not find module vmblock
> modinfo: could not find module vmci
> modinfo: could not find module vsock
> modinfo: could not find module vmmon
> modinfo: could not find module vmnet
> modinfo: could not find module vmblock
> modinfo: could not find module vmci
> modinfo: could not find module vsock
> /usr/bin/vmware: line 31:  7749 Segmentation fault
> "$BINDIR"/vmware-modconfig --appname="VMware Workstation"
> --icon="vmware-workstation"
>
>   
try:

mv /usr/lib/vmware/modules/binary  /usr/lib/vmware/modules/binary.old

then

vmware-modconfig --console --install-all
